What should I do under this situation?

Hi All,

I'm porting new wifi driver into openwrt with backports.
Insert wifi driver and use wpa_supplicant to control wifi chip, anything looks good.
But, once I put wireless config into /etc/config/wireless, wifi chip keep scanning and not working anymore. Looks following logs.

[   15.082983] CFG80211-ERROR) wl_run_escan : [   15.087019] LEGACY_SCAN sync ID: 4660, bssidx: 0
[   15.385840]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.437335]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 58:d5:6e:7e:67:d3, status 8 
[   15.491647]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 58:d5:6e:7e:67:d3, status 8 
[   15.545092]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.552445]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.675891]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.683186]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.690466]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.714122]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.721393]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.791211]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.839362]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.880143]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   15.893607]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   16.007636]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 00:1f:ff:00:00:00, status 0 
[   17.053567] CFG80211-ERROR) wl_run_escan : [   17.057610] LEGACY_SCAN sync ID: 4660, bssidx: 0
[   17.406302]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 58:d5:6e:7e:67:d3, status 8 
[   17.443227]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 58:d5:6e:7e:67:d3, status 8 
[   17.514927]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.522195]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.532005]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.561849]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.604057]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.641113]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.648391]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.681410]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.688683]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.725406]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.732674]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.811536]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.839245]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.852111]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.941641]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C dc:d9:16:82:64:68, status 8 
[   17.972775] MACEVENT: WLC_E_ESCAN_RESULT 69, MAC 00:0c:00:00:dd:18, status 0 

So, my question is how should I fix this issue? Please advise. Thanks.

This file is empty at the beginning? Normally there should be a default config for every detected wifi device.

Yes, default is empty. After I run "wifi config" , enable radio0 and set STA mode to connect my AP.
But wifi keep scanning. It confuse me.